Wroth contributions or tax deferred contributions are two good things. It's not like one is dramatically better than the other, but in some situations it's better to use one. Your employer match is always tax deferred money, even if you make a wroth contribution. If you're knocking on the door of the estate tax exemption, doing wroth conversions can help you avoid estate taxes as well.
